June in Fulham, United Kingdom showcases a delightful mix of warm days and refreshing showers. The maximum temperature can soar to 31°C (89°F), while the average sits comfortably at 16°C (62°F), making it a pleasant month for outdoor activities. However, the month is not without its variability, as visitors can expect about 77 mm (3.0 in) of rainfall over 9 days, contributing to the region's characteristic lush greenery. With humidity levels reaching 80%, the air often feels warm and inviting, making June an ideal time to explore the vibrant streets and parks of Fulham.

June marks a noticeable uptick in precipitation in Fulham, United Kingdom, with 77 mm (3.0 in) of rain falling over 9 days. This increase reflects the transition from the drier spring months, such as April with just 33 mm (1.3 in), to the more variable summer climate. With a total that surpasses not only May's 62 mm (2.5 in) but also looks ahead to the wetter months like October, June establishes itself as a significant month for rainfall. As summer approaches, the UV Index in Fulham, United Kingdom, reaches a peak in June with a rating of 8, categorizing the exposure as very high. This considerable increase from May's 7 signals a need for heightened sun protection, as the burn time dramatically reduces to just 15 minutes. Notably, this trend of increasing UV levels continues into July, sustaining the same intensity. In June, Fulham, United Kingdom basks in an impressive 16 hours of daylight, marking the peak of the year and a continuation of the steady increase seen from just 8 hours in January. As spring blossoms into summer, the gradual elongation of daylight is evident—rising from 9 hours in February to a striking 15 hours in May, before reaching its zenith in June. In June, Fulham experiences a gentle breeze with an average wind speed of 3.1 m/s (7 mph), marking one of the calmest months of the year. Following the slightly more blustery months of April and May, where winds picked up to 3.5 m/s and 4.2 m/s respectively, June's milder conditions create a tranquil atmosphere perfect for enjoying the outdoors. As the summer begins, the wind speeds remain relatively low, with only a slight increase to 3.3 m/s (7 mph) in July, suggesting a trend towards more stable and pleasant weather as the days grow longer.
